I've found the following issue with the way servicemix works in JBOS.

I'am building endpoints that use the ervicemix-http component.

For this to work I need to add these two files to the
$JBOSS_HOME/server/default/lib folder :
1- geronimo-j2ee-management_1.0_spec-1.0.1.jar
2- commons-httpclient-3.0.jar

The geronimo-j2ee-management jar is required by the .sar file (Should this
not be included in the sar archive ?)

The Common-httpclient is required by the servicemix-http module (however
there is an older version of this lib included with JBoss).  So for this too
work we have to delete the old version and replace it with this version.
The ideal work around would be to include a jboss-web.xml file that
specifies to jboss that we want to use our versino of common-httpclient for
this application.
